Study Summary

The primary hypothesis is that preterm infants who are less than or equal to 32 weeks gestation and weigh 1001-2500 grams at birth will have an increase in weight gain with a feeding goal of 180-200 ml/kg/day more than the commonly used feeding goal of 140-160 ml/kg/day
